Introduction to Shapes and Colors When it comes to introducing babies to shapes and colors, it's essential to start with the basics. Begin with simple shapes like squares and circles, and gradually introduce more complex shapes like triangles and rectangles. Use real-life objects to demonstrate the different shapes, making it easier for babies to understand. For example, you can use a ball to demonstrate a circle or a book to demonstrate a square.
